Vernon Arthur Sponsler of Altoona died at his home on Wednesday, December 2. He was born at Everett on February 27, 1897, a son of Arthur and Ida Sponsler. He was twice married, first to Margaret Patton who died in 1946, and later to Berta M. Kennedy. Surviving are his wife, two sons, Robert, in California and William of Rochester, N. Y. Five grandchildren, and three sisters and a brother also surviv: Mrs. Catherine Shoemaker of baltimore, Mrs. Mary Penning of Asbury Park, N. J., and Mrs. Ethel Mahone of Newport News, Va., and Theodore Sponsler of Warren. Mr. Sponsler was a veteran of World War I and a brakeman for the Pennsylvania Railroad, a member of Grace Methodist Church, B. of R.T.B. of L.F. and E., the Altoona Eagles, Elks and Moose, the Tyrone VFW and Blazing Arrow Fire Co., the New Cumberland American Legion and the D.A.V.
